German CDU leader Friedrich Merz has defended the trial of an Irish man in Germany, asserting it is not a “show trial” during a visit to Dublin. Merz expressed confidence in the German judicial system, stating its processes adhere to internationally recognized standards. His comments come amid scrutiny surrounding the case and concerns raised about its fairness. While details of the case remain limited in this report, Merz’s intervention aims to reassure observers about the integrity of the German legal proceedings. He made the remarks while on a visit to the Irish capital, signaling the importance of maintaining strong bilateral relations. This statement seeks to quell potential diplomatic friction and reinforce trust in the rule of law within Germany.
